Marist Red Foxes at Dartmouth Big Green
Hanover, New Hampshire; Sunday, 2 p.m. EST
BOTTOM LINE: Marist takes on Dartmouth after Rhyjon Blackwell scored 24 points in Marist’s 66-62 loss to the Xavier Musketeers.
Dartmouth went 14-14 overall with a 9-4 record at home during the 2024-25 season. The Big Green shot 43.7% from the field and 35.2% from 3-point range last season.
Marist finished 9-5 on the road and 20-10 overall last season. The Red Foxes averaged 5.8 steals, 3.4 blocks and 11.0 turnovers per game last season.
